Toni-Lynn Chetirkin, LPCC
*Licensed Professional Clinical Counselor
*CA BBS Clinical Supervisor
*EMDR Trauma Clinician
*Registered Art Therapist
*Certified Yoga Teacher (200 Hr.)
*Critical Incident Stress Debriefing
(CISD) facilitator
*American Red Cross Disaster Relief
Mental Health Volunteer
My educational background includes a Bachelor of Arts degree in Psychology from the University of Saint Joseph in West Haven, CT and a Master of Arts degree in Counseling Psychology with an emphasis in Art Therapy from Albertus Magnus College in New Haven, CT. I completed my post-graduate licensure requirements on the Monterey Peninsula and have held an active license since 2012.
Shortly after being licensed, I pursued advanced training (levels I, II, & III) in EMDR trauma therapy with Dr. Laurel Parnell at the Esalen Institute in Big Sur, CA. I also obtained specialized training in the areas of psychedelic-assisted therapy & integration support, Internal Family Systems, Somatic Experiencing, Reiki levels I & II, and chakra energy healing.
With close to 20 years of professional experience I've worked with children, adolescents and adults in a wide variety of settings. In addition to private practice, I also treat at-risk, socioeconomically disadvantaged teens struggling with anxiety, depression, and complex trauma in an alternative education setting. Prior to this, I also worked in psychiatric in-patient facilities, residential group homes, forensic rehabilitation programs, health and wellness centers, and global disaster relief efforts.
Purpose & Intention
My passions for being physically active in nature, art history, world travel, preservation of Indigenous ceremony and land, animal rights, global relief efforts and sacred plant medicine have all been powerful forces along my path to becoming a psychotherapist, journeyer, artist, guide, teacher, and mother. A life long study of Native American spiritual traditions and personal soul journeying guide me on my path and in the creation of a sacred space for my clients.
My counseling orientation is influenced by the fields of Jungian and Existential Psychology. My therapeutic approach is client-centered and lead by the assumption that all people have the innate ability to heal themselves when they are able to access their mind-body's natural tendency to move toward balance, integration, and adaptation. While placing great emphasis on the therapeutic relationship and in the creation of a sacred space, my role is to guide clients in this process.
Using both verbal and non-verbal methods, my intention is for clients to begin thinking, feeling, and relating in ways that enable them to reconnect with their authentic selves, regain wholeness, discover their life purpose, and actualize their full potential, while living joyfully in the world with others. I view each client as a unique individual and therapeutic techniques will always honor this connection.
